The master branch has been updated by Alan Modra <amodra@sourceware.org>: https://sourceware.org/git/gitweb.cgi?p=binutils-gdb.git;h=1b86808a86077722ee4f42ff97f836b12420bb2a commit 1b86808a86077722ee4f42ff97f836b12420bb2a Author: Alan Modra <amodra@gmail.com> Date: Tue Sep 26 21:47:24 2017 +0930 PR22209, invalid memory read in find_abstract_instance_name This patch adds bounds checking for DW_FORM_ref_addr die refs, and calculates them relative to the first .debug_info section. See the big comment for why calculating relative to the current .debug_info section was wrong for relocatable object files. PR 22209 * dwarf2.c (struct comp_unit): Delete sec_info_ptr field. (find_abstract_instance_name): Calculate DW_FORM_ref_addr relative to stash->info_ptr_memory, and check die_ref is within that memory. Set info_ptr_end correctly when another CU is refd. Check die_ref for DW_FORM_ref4 etc. is within CU. Fixed |
